Please help me with this: I have iVault on two computers.  I have information on one, I want to copy to the other.  Restoring the backup from computer A to computer B results in a specified path unavailable error, and exporting to a plain text file doesn't work because there's no import feature.  So how do I get the info from one to the other?

I finally figured out how it can be done, but it was not very intuitive and it had some problems.  I did a backup of iVault with iVaults backup on computer A, I installed iVault on computer B and in iVault on compute B, opened the file.  It then had the new vault and backed-up vaults open.  Then I dragged the info from one to the other.  The problem was, I couldn't just open the file and use it, I had to drag the info from the backup file to the new vault.
